Subject: [RFC 6/6] VSOCK: Add Makefile and Kconfig
Date: Wed, 27 May 2015 18:06:00 +0100 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1432746360-14940-7-git-send-email-stefanha@redhat.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1432746360-14940-1-git-send-email-stefanha@redhat.com>
From: Asias He <asias@redhat.com>
Enable virtio-vsock and vhost-vsock.
Signed-off-by: Asias He <asias@redhat.com>
Signed-off-by: Stefan Hajnoczi <stefanha@redhat.com>
---
drivers/vhost/Kconfig | 4 ++++
drivers/vhost/Kconfig.vsock | 7 +++++++
drivers/vhost/Makefile | 4 ++++
net/vmw_vsock/Kconfig | 18 ++++++++++++++++++
net/vmw_vsock/Makefile | 2 ++
5 files changed, 35 insertions(+)
create mode 100644 drivers/vhost/Kconfig.vsock
diff --git a/drivers/vhost/Kconfig b/drivers/vhost/Kconfig
index 017a1e8..169fb19 100644
--- a/drivers/vhost/Kconfig
+++ b/drivers/vhost/Kconfig
@@ -32,3 +32,7 @@ config VHOST
---help---
This option is selected by any driver which needs to access
the core of vhost.
+
+if STAGING
+source "drivers/vhost/Kconfig.vsock"
+endif
diff --git a/drivers/vhost/Kconfig.vsock b/drivers/vhost/Kconfig.vsock
new file mode 100644
index 0000000..3491865
--- /dev/null
+++ b/drivers/vhost/Kconfig.vsock
@@ -0,0 +1,7 @@
+config VHOST_VSOCK
+ tristate "vhost virtio-vsock driver"
+ depends on VSOCKETS && EVENTFD
+ select VIRTIO_VSOCKETS_COMMON
+ default n
+ ---help---
+ Say M here to enable the vhost-vsock for virtio-vsock guests
diff --git a/drivers/vhost/Makefile b/drivers/vhost/Makefile
index e0441c3..6b012b9 100644
--- a/drivers/vhost/Makefile
+++ b/drivers/vhost/Makefile
@@ -4,5 +4,9 @@ vhost_net-y := net.o
obj-$(CONFIG_VHOST_SCSI) += vhost_scsi.o
vhost_scsi-y := scsi.o
+obj-$(CONFIG_VHOST_VSOCK) += vhost_vsock.o
+vhost_vsock-y := vsock.o
+
obj-$(CONFIG_VHOST_RING) += vringh.o
+
obj-$(CONFIG_VHOST) += vhost.o
diff --git a/net/vmw_vsock/Kconfig b/net/vmw_vsock/Kconfig
index 14810ab..74e0bc8 100644
--- a/net/vmw_vsock/Kconfig
+++ b/net/vmw_vsock/Kconfig
@@ -26,3 +26,21 @@ config VMWARE_VMCI_VSOCKETS
To compile this driver as a module, choose M here: the module
will be called vmw_vsock_vmci_transport. If unsure, say N.
+
+config VIRTIO_VSOCKETS
+ tristate "virtio transport for Virtual Sockets"
+ depends on VSOCKETS && VIRTIO
+ select VIRTIO_VSOCKETS_COMMON
+ help
+ This module implements a virtio transport for Virtual Sockets.
+
+ Enable this transport if your Virtual Machine runs on Qemu/KVM.
+
+ To compile this driver as a module, choose M here: the module
+ will be called virtio_vsock_transport. If unsure, say N.
+
+config VIRTIO_VSOCKETS_COMMON
+ tristate
+ ---help---
+ This option is selected by any driver which needs to access
+ the virtio_vsock.
diff --git a/net/vmw_vsock/Makefile b/net/vmw_vsock/Makefile
index 2ce52d7..cf4c294 100644
--- a/net/vmw_vsock/Makefile
+++ b/net/vmw_vsock/Makefile
@@ -1,5 +1,7 @@
obj-$(CONFIG_VSOCKETS) += vsock.o
obj-$(CONFIG_VMWARE_VMCI_VSOCKETS) += vmw_vsock_vmci_transport.o
+obj-$(CONFIG_VIRTIO_VSOCKETS) += virtio_transport.o
+obj-$(CONFIG_VIRTIO_VSOCKETS_COMMON) += virtio_transport_common.o
vsock-y += af_vsock.o vsock_addr.o
--
